ABOUT THE COMPANY

We are tupu, an early stage Berlin-based start-up with the vision to create a carbon neutral, circular food production system that will change the way we produce and consume food. Using data driven technology and highly efficient land usage we are able to manufacture environmentally friendly products, hence, reducing CO2 emissions.

We are looking for a passionate and mission-driven Mechanical Engineer (m/f/d) to shape one of the most booming and future-critical industries with us. You will work very closely with the founders and become an integral part of our company.

Tasks

Different from traditional farms, our farms rely on automation technologies as an integral part of our production systems. As a mechanical engineer, you will have the opportunity to influence tupu s technical direction and design, prototype, plan, and execute innovative solutions for our farms. You ll be working in close collaboration with our CTO & COO, robotics engineer, and farm operations team to reshape the mushroom farming industry.

Your role will be multi-disciplinary across design, prototyping, validating and testing, but will also include strategic thinking and project planning.

THE CHALLENGES YOU LL FACE

  • Design, prototype, and oversee tupu s mechanical and automation systems (Integration of mechanics, robotics, electronics, hydraulic and pneumatic system, etc.)
  • Lead continuous improvement projects to maximize yield, capacity and capability via hardware initiatives
  • Communicate effectively with different departments and project stakeholders
  • Technical responsibility from conception to implementation, reporting and coordination with the project team
  • Prototype new components to manipulate various farm tools
  • Troubleshoot mechanical issues from the field
  • Present data/trade-offs to facilitate design decisions
  • Document failures, issues and rectifications of mechanical systems
  • Prepare risk assessments and method statements, manuals and work instructions
  • Work with cross-functional internal and external teams (e.g. R&D, Operations, etc.) to ensure requests are executed
  • Build/Manage workshop and assembly space

Requirements

  • You hold at least a M.Sc. in Mechanical Engineering, Industrial Engineering, Robotics, or similar and have +4 years of practical and theoretical engineering experience. Experience in farm automation is a plus.
  • You are a skilled user of CAD systems (CATIA or Solidworks).
  • Structured problem-solving techniques such as Five Why (5W) and Eight Disciplines (8D)
  • Familiar with state-of-the-art manufacturing methods DFM (Design for Manufacturing) and Lean.
  • Experience with automated manufacturing equipment
  • Work-related experience in injection forming and vacuum molding would be a plus.
  • Test and validation procedures and evidence of troubleshooting and finding rapid solutions
  • You are fluent in English and German
